MHG29558 - Stone Axehead and Arrowhead - Cullernie
Summary
Prehistoric stone axe head and flint arrowhead.

Full Description
Stone axe-head. Associated with other finds recovered from the periphery from the cairn near-by including a leaf-shaped arrowhead, a large flint point and pieces of cremated bone.
Alan Ross, 2000
